Mehdi Hasan, a talented journalist and editor-in-chief of Zeteo, joins for a fiery discussion on the alarming state of American politics. He tackles the normalization of Trump's extreme behavior and the erosion of democratic norms, highlighting how media complicity contributes to this crisis. Mehdi critiques the Democratic leadership for their weakness and advocates for bold communicators. He also addresses the rising tide of Islamophobia as a byproduct of Trump's rhetoric while expressing his enduring belief in American democratic ideals.
